MainStage for Musical Theatre — Using Aliases
In Apple MainStage, aliases are linked shortcuts to a sound patch that can be reused, without the need for new instances of the instrument and plugins used on the channel strip. They are extremely useful for reoccurring sounds, and help to reduce CPU load and RAM usage.
Say you have an acoustic piano patch that shows up in every single song. Instead of creating a unique patch for each instance, you can use an alias to tell MainStage…”Hey, just take this earlier piano patch and use it here!”. This means there won’t be any duplicate instances of effects on the piano patch taking up resources.
MainStage for Musical Theatre — Filtering Controllers
By default, MIDI controllers such as sustain pedals, expression pedals, and modulation wheels affect every channel strip in a patch. Sometimes it’s useful to be able to filter out certain controllers in a patch. Apple MainStage lets you do the channel strip level. I’ve been programming keyboards in MainStage for a production of Bat Boy over the past few weeks. One of the patches in the Keyboard 2 book calls for winds over strings. I try not to use the sustain pedal when playing strings, but I have to in this situation. There’s a page turn in the middle of a held string chord. I only wanted the sustain pedal to affect the strings, so I had to filter out the sustain pedal for the wind channel strips. Here’s how I did it. It’s really simple.
MainStage for Musical Theatre — The Importance of Panning
An often overlooked part of creating sound patches in Apple MainStage is panning individual instruments across the stereo image. Sample libraries are usually recorded from center perspective. If your sound patch consists of strings, flutes, clarinets, and a celeste, it’s going to sound pretty muddy if they’re all sounding from center perspective. Panning is the process of moving sounds across the stereo image, and it will help you create better sounding patches.
MainStage for Musical Theatre — Pitch Bends in EXS24
I programmed keyboards in Apple MainStage for a production of The Wedding Singer two years ago. In “Saturday Night in the City,” the Keyboard 2 book starts off with a huge synth lead pitch bend from to A2 to A5, and then another pitch bend from A5 to D6. EXS24’s standard pitch bend parameters allow bending up one octave, and bending down three octaves. Take a look at this screenshot of the EXS24 interface.

MainStage for Musical Theatre — Creating Sound Patches
In musical theatre, a sound patch refers to one or more sounds grouped into one playable entity. Different sounds within the patch can also be layered on top of each other, or split at different points across the keyboard. MainStage for Musical Theatre — Getting Started
Apple MainStage used to be part of Logic Studio, which was $499. Now, it’s available as a standalone app on the App Store for $29. It’s possibly the best deal in music software history. After you buy and install MainStage, click “Download Additional Content” under “MainStage” in the menu bar. These are free sounds that can be used in MainStage. I recommend only downloading the instruments and not the Apple Loops.
